News summary

Lando Norris has stepped away from social media, citing a lack of enjoyment and viewing it as a waste of time and energy, as he focuses on his mental approach amid a fierce Formula 1 title battle with teammate Oscar Piastri. Despite winning the season opener in Melbourne, Norris has struggled to keep pace with Piastri, who currently leads the championship by 16 points. Norris likened his social media avoidance to that of former world champion Kimi Raikkonen, emphasizing his preference for spending time with friends, playing golf, and training. Known for his openness about mental health and self-critical nature, Norris has chosen to prioritize real-life interactions over digital distractions. Meanwhile, Lewis Hamilton also attracted attention for unfollowing all accounts on Instagram ahead of the Emilia-Romagna Grand Prix. This shift among top drivers highlights a growing trend of distancing from social media amidst intense competitive pressures.
